dec 16, 1773 - Boston Tea Party
Description:
The Boston Tea Party was an act of rebellion against the Tea Act. A group of Sons of Liberty, disguised as Mohawks, boarded three ships and dumped 342 crates, or 92,000 pounds of tea into the harbor. Britain was furious at the colonists and decided they needed to be punished.
